1. An electric cable comprising at least one conducting core and at least one electrically insulating coating obtained by extruding onto said conducting core a polymeric composition comprising an effective amount of a peroxide cross-linking agent and subsequently cross-linking the composition vie peroxide, said composition further comprising a polyolefin polymeric base consisting essentially of an ethylene polymer and, in parts by weight relative to the total weight thereof amounts:

  • from 0.5 to 15 parts of ester groups; and

    from 0.01 to 5 parts of epoxy groups, said amounts of ester and epoxy groups, in combination, being such as to reduce the formation of water trees within the insulation coating after electric ageing in water, wherein said ester and epoxy groups are provided by an ethylene/acrylic ester/glycidyl methacrylate terpolymer having a Melt Index of from 0.1 g/10′

    to 40 g/10′

    .
